You owe this to yourself and your tank.

I was recently looking for some of those pesty snails as one of my zoo colonies looked aggravated. Even up close I was having trouble getting a good look. I went and got a pair of those 1.75 magnifying reading glasses that you can get just about anywhere and WOW is all I can say. Imaging watching your entire tank as if it were a macro photo. Thats what you will get. Things take on a totally different look and things you didnt know even existed will show . Do it and I promiss you wont regret it. I keep the glasses right by the tank now, I bet you will too.
